Student assaulted in school by unidentified persons

Image
Press Trust of India Salem (TN)
Last Updated : Dec 01 2014 | 9:30 PM IST
A 17-year-old student of a government school was assaulted by two unidentified persons in the school premises today, police said.
Santosh Kumar of Nadupatty Government Model school was playing with other students when two bike-borne persons entered the premises and slashed his neck and hands with a blade, Inspector S Sureshkumar said.
The assailants escaped after the incident, Sureshkumar said, adding, the motive for the attack was not known.
The boy was admitted to a private hospital and his condition is stable, he said.
